Removing the Pressure Gauge
1. Turn off the welder and unplug main power.
2. Turn air pressure to zero, then disconnect main air supply.

4. Disconnect the air line from the Pressure Gauge
5. Hold the pressure gauge against the nose cover; then loosen the two retaining nuts

6. Remove the retaining nuts and brackets
7. From the front of the welder, pull the Pressure Gauge out of the welder

Replacing the Pressure Gauge
To replace the Pressure Gauge, reverse the instructions above.

General Warning
Turn air pressure to zero and disconnect the main air supply. Failure
to do this leave the welder under potentially dangerous air pressure.

General Warning
Make sure all air lines are securely connected. Failure to do this can
cause air pressure to disconnect an insecure air line when turning air
pressure on.
